Episode 15: Becoming Debt Free at 27 with Maggie Kroll 08.10.2019

At just 27 years old, Maggie Kroll paid off over 70,000 dollars in debt and became debt-free. In today's episode, she talks about the steps that started her on the debt-free journey, the best part of having no debt and advice she'd give to her younger self. Episode 13: We Paid of $9,500 in 3 Months! Here's How We Did It 24.09.2019

On today's episode, I'm sharing how John and I were able to pay off John's student loans. John had around $20,000 in student loans and prior to getting married, he had paid off a good portion. After the wedding & honeymoon, we decided to get crazy and pay off the remaining balance in just THREE months.
